1. The Core Document Lifecycle Overview

Every project travels through a sequence of stages from initial idea to final handover. At each stage, specific documents are created, reviewed, and signed off:

Initiation Phase: Business Case (Justifying the project) and the Project Initiation Document (PID) (The master blueprint and contract).
Execution & Monitoring Phase: Highlight/Progress Reports (Tracking status) and Issue Logs / Change Request Forms (Managing unexpected changes).
Closure Phase: Lessons Learned / Post-Project Review Report (Evaluating success and capturing insights for the future).

Key Takeaway

Documents are not just "paperwork"—they protect the business by defining what will be delivered, what it will cost, who is in charge, and how success is measured.

2. The Business Case: The Starting Point

Before an organisation commits time, money, and staff to a major venture, it needs to ask one fundamental question: "Is this project worth doing?" The Business Case provides this strategic and financial justification.

Core Elements of a Business Case

Problem / Opportunity Definition: Explains clearly what operational issue needs solving or what market opportunity the business wants to seize.
Strategic Fit: Proves how the project aligns directly with the organisation's overall long-term goals and corporate strategy.
Options Appraisal: Evaluates different ways to solve the problem (e.g., Option 1: Do nothing; Option 2: Upgrade existing systems; Option 3: Purchase an entirely new bespoke system).
Cost-Benefit Analysis: Weighs the total anticipated costs against the quantifiable financial and non-financial gains.
Expected Benefits: Clearly outlines the positive outcomes (e.g., faster transaction times, increased market share).
Initial Risk Assessment: Highlights major threats that could stop the project from delivering its expected value.

3. The Project Initiation Document (PID): The Master Contract

Once the Business Case is approved, the Project Initiation Document (PID) is created. The PID is the single most vital document in the CCEA curriculum. It acts as the definitive agreement between the Project Sponsor / Project Board and the Project Manager.

Key Components of the Standard PID Template

A. Project Details & Metadata

This section sets the official identity of the project. It includes:
Project Title: The formal name of the project.
Project Sponsor: The senior business owner/executive who funds and champions the project.
Client Name: The internal or external beneficiary.
Project Manager Name: The individual responsible for day-to-day operational control.
Key Dates: Official Start Date and scheduled End Date.
Approved Total Budget/Cost: The agreed financial ceiling.

B. Document Control & Approvals

Version Control: Tracks document revisions (e.g., Version 1.0, Version 1.1) to ensure everyone works from the latest information.
Sign-Offs: Formal signatures from key governance personnel (e.g., Project Board, Executive, Sponsor) granting permission to spend funds and begin work.
Distribution List: A register of all named stakeholders who must receive updated copies of the PID.

C. Project Aims & Strategic Purpose

A high-level summary that explains the core reason the project exists and what broader business problem it will solve.

D. SMART Project Objectives

To avoid ambiguity, project goals must be broken down into clear, structured objectives across key operational areas:
Software: Development, procurement, and deployment.
Hardware: Physical infrastructure, servers, and devices.
Testing: Quality assurance and technical validation.
Training & Change Management: Preparing staff and updating business processes.
Facilities: Physical workspace, accommodation, and site alterations.

Each objective must be SMART (Specific, Measurable, Achievable, Relevant, Time-bound) and explicitly state its allocated staff, resource requirements, costs, and deadlines.

Example of a Weak Objective: "Improve the IT system quickly."
Example of a Strong SMART Objective: "Install and test 50 new EPOS hardware terminals across all retail branches by 30th November, managed by the Lead IT Technician within an allocated budget of £25,000."

E. Project Scope and Exclusions (Managing Scope Creep)

In-Scope: Explicitly lists every task, system, and deliverable that the project team is contracted to deliver.
Out-of-Scope (Exclusions): Explicitly states what is not included.
Why are exclusions vital? They prevent Scope Creep—the gradual, uncontrolled expansion of project boundaries without extra time or budget!

F. Governance Structure & Stakeholder Analysis

A structured organisational chart defining key roles and decision-making authority:
Project Sponsor: The ultimate decision-maker and funder who owns the Business Case.
Project Manager: Plans, directs, and manages daily tasks and resources.
Senior Supplier: Represents those designing, building, or supplying the technical deliverables.
Senior User: Represents the end-users who will operate the system day-to-day.
Stakeholder Register: Identifies external and internal groups, their specific responsibilities, and their vested interests.

G. Stakeholder Communication Plan

A structured matrix ensuring smooth, predictable information flow. It specifies:
1. Target Audience: Who needs the update (e.g., Store Managers, Executive Board).
2. Information Needed: What data they require (e.g., milestone progress, training schedules).
3. Medium/Channel: How it will be shared (e.g., weekly email briefing, monthly board presentation).
4. Frequency: How often it happens (e.g., daily, weekly, monthly).
5. Owner: Who is responsible for sending it.

H. Risk Management Plan & Quantitative Risk Matrix

Risk management requires a structured numerical approach. Potential threats are identified, scored, and managed:

The Risk Severity Formula:
\(Risk\ Severity = Probability \times Impact\)

Probability (\(P\)): The numerical likelihood of the risk happening.
Impact (\(I\)): The numerical severity of the disruption if it occurs.
Mitigation Measure: Proactive actions taken beforehand to reduce the probability or impact.
Contingency Action: Reactive plans put into effect after the risk occurs to minimise damage.

I. Project Deliverables & Milestones

Identifies key checkpoints, major stage completions, and scheduled handover dates that directly align with the project's overall schedule, such as its Gantt chart and Critical Path.

Key Takeaway

The PID is the ultimate baseline. If a dispute arises over deadlines, budget, or specifications, the PID provides the definitive answer.

4. Monitoring, Controlling, and Closure Documentation

Projects rarely go 100% according to plan. Structured documentation keeps projects on track when challenges arise.

A. Highlight / Progress Reports

Regular, scheduled summary reports produced by the Project Manager for the Project Sponsor / Board. They summarise:
• Work completed in the current reporting period.
• Progress against scheduled milestones.
• Actual financial spend versus budgeted spend.
• Emerging risks or operational issues requiring executive attention.

B. Issue Log & Change Request Form

Issue Log: A live register of real, currently occurring problems that cannot be handled through routine management and need immediate resolution.
Change Request Form: A formal document used whenever someone wants to alter the agreed scope, deadline, or budget. It assesses the impact of the proposed change before the Project Board formally approves or rejects it.

C. Lessons Learned / Post-Project Review Report

Created during project closure, this document provides formal evaluation:
• Evaluates whether the original SMART objectives and business benefits were achieved.
• Captures operational successes and mistakes to build organisational knowledge for future projects.
• Details the final handover of deliverables to operational business-as-usual staff.

5. Exam Pitfalls & Success Strategies

Don't worry if memorising all these components feels demanding at first! Reviewing these common pitfalls will help you avoid easy mistakes in your assessment:

Avoid Vague Objectives: Never write qualitative statements like "make the software user-friendly." Always include specific targets, deadlines, costs, and named owners.
Use Numerical Risk Scoring: In the risk section, don't just write "High Risk." Always apply numerical scoring using \(P \times I\) (\(Probability \times Impact\)) alongside specific mitigation and contingency steps.
Don't Confuse Sponsor and Manager: Remember: the Project Sponsor owns the budget and chairs the board; the Project Manager runs the day-to-day tasks.
Always Include Out-of-Scope Items: Stating what you will not do is just as important as stating what you will do to prevent scope creep.
Maintain Total Consistency: Ensure that every cost, date, and milestone in your PID matches the data in your Gantt charts and financial calculations exactly.

Quick Review Summary

Business Case: Justifies why the project should start (Costs vs. Benefits).
PID: Defines how the project will be run, governed, and measured.
Highlight Reports: Monitor progress against the baseline during execution.
Change Requests / Issue Logs: Control scope changes and resolve live problems.
Post-Project Review: Evaluates benefit achievement and records lessons learned.
